Thankyou for the welcome guys.
I have a few tuning tools to assist and test some things.
I will be running my old Gtech Dyno to test 0-100s .
I want to measure improvements with the larger throtal body and other mods first and hopefully get it going a bit better N/A.
A Wide Band kit to keep on-top of air/fuel ratios and assist with a ECU tune which I'm going to have download because there's nobody around here , but I will know the AFR's so that will help whoever does a tune.
I plan to run some Exhaust Cutouts with the electric valves , and possibly run a X pipe in place of the rear cats to help it scavenging.
And I have a NOS fogger kit to drop in a nitrous shot for 1/8th drags, and that's really where I expect the car to preform better, I will spray a 75hp NOS shot but will up it to a 125hp if possible
